About You.bot | Save ~90% on AI APIs

You.bot is a powerful AI API aggregator and unified gateway designed to help developers and businesses reduce AI integration costs and simplify model management by leveraging artificial intelligence, automated routing, and a centralized API infrastructure . By providing a single point of access to over 76 of the world's leading AI models, the platform eliminates the need for multiple individual subscriptions and complex integrations, allowing users to save up to 90% on their overall model usage expenses. The primary problem the tool solves is the fragmentation of the current AI landscape. As new Large Language Models (LLMs), image generators, and coding assistants are released weekly, developers often find themselves trapped in a cycle of managing dozens of different API keys, disparate billing cycles, and varying documentation standards. You.bot streamlines this process by acting as a middle layer, offering a unified API that grants instant access to a massive library of top-tier models. This allows teams to experiment, iterate, and scale their AI-driven applications without the financial and technical overhead associated with managing multiple third-party vendor relationships. This tool is specifically engineered for software developers, AI engineers, SaaS founders, and enterprise organizations that aim to integrate generative AI into their products. Whether the goal is to build a sophisticated AI chatbot, an automated content generation engine, or a complex research tool, You.bot provides the necessary infrastructure to maintain affordability and operational efficiency. By utilizing high-intent AI routing and economies of scale, it ensures that businesses can access the most capable models in the industry while keeping their operational costs sustainable. Why People Use You.bot The core motivation for utilizing You.bot lies in the pursuit of operational efficiency and financial sustainability. In traditional AI implementation, a developer wishing to use GPT-4, Claude, and Midjourney would need to maintain three separate accounts, manage three different payment methods, and write three different sets of integration code. This manual approach is not only time-consuming but also creates significant technical debt as the project scales. You.bot replaces this fragmented workflow with a streamlined hub, allowing developers to call any supported model using a consistent syntax. Beyond the technical simplicity, the financial incentive is a primary driver. Direct API costs can escalate rapidly as user bases grow, often eating into the profit margins of AI-powered SaaS products. By leveraging the platform's optimized routing and bulk access, users can significantly lower the cost per token or per image generated. This shifts the focus from managing costs to optimizing the user experience. Furthermore, the AI field evolves at an unprecedented pace. A model that is industry-leading today may be surpassed by a more efficient or capable version tomorrow. People use You.bot to future-proof their applications; instead of rewriting entire modules of code to switch model providers, they can simply update a parameter in their API call to point to a new model, ensuring their product always utilizes the most advanced technology available. About Hanabi.rest

Opening Overview Hanabi.rest is a powerful AI-powered API building platform designed to help developers and creators generate fully functional REST APIs by leveraging artificial intelligence, natural language processing, and intelligent backend automation . By transforming conversational descriptions into structured code and operational endpoints, the tool eliminates the need for extensive manual coding during the initial phases of backend development. It solves the primary problem of the steep learning curve and time-consuming nature of boilerplate coding, allowing users to describe their data requirements and logic in plain English rather than writing hundreds of lines of repetitive code. The platform utilizes advanced large language models to interpret user intent, mapping natural language requests to specific API architectures. This process includes the automatic generation of endpoints, the definition of request and response schemas, and the configuration of database interactions. By automating the structural foundation of a backend service, Hanabi.rest enables a more agile development cycle where the transition from an idea to a working prototype happens in a fraction of the traditional time. This tool is primarily designed for software engineers, full-stack developers, startup founders, and rapid prototypers who need to deploy scalable backend services quickly. Whether the goal is to build a Minimum Viable Product (MVP) or to integrate complex AI functionalities into an existing ecosystem, Hanabi.rest provides a streamlined environment that democratizes access to sophisticated backend capabilities. By focusing on high-level logic rather than low-level syntax, users can accelerate their deployment timelines and reduce the technical overhead associated with API maintenance. Why People Use Hanabi.rest The core motivation for using Hanabi.rest lies in the desire to bypass the tedious and error-prone process of manual API construction. In traditional development workflows, creating a REST API requires a developer to manually set up a server, define routing logic, create database schemas, implement controllers, and handle HTTP methods and status codes. This process is often repetitive and consumes a significant portion of the development cycle before any actual business logic is implemented. Hanabi.rest shifts this paradigm by allowing the AI to handle the structural heavy lifting, enabling the developer to act as an architect rather than a manual coder. Furthermore, many developers and entrepreneurs struggle with the "blank page" problem when designing an API. Deciding on the most efficient endpoint structure or the most logical database relationship can lead to analysis paralysis. By using a natural language interface, users can experiment with different API structures in real-time. If a requirement changes, the user can simply describe the modification, and the AI updates the API accordingly. This level of flexibility is nearly impossible to achieve with manual coding without significant refactoring efforts. The transition from manual coding to AI-assisted API generation also significantly lowers the barrier to entry for non-technical founders or junior developers. It allows them to produce professional-grade backend services that follow industry standards without needing years of expertise in specific backend frameworks. The result is a massive increase in productivity, as the time spent on configuration and setup is redirected toward innovation, user experience, and feature enhancement.
